This Top Five Classics edition of PRIDE AND PREJUDICE includes:
• 36 full-color illustrations from the 1898 and 1907 editions by the brothers Charles E. and Henry M. Brock
• an informative Introduction
• a detailed Author Bio and Bibliography
“It is a truth universally acknowledged, that a single man in possession of a good fortune must be in want of a wife.”
So begins one of the most popular and beloved novels of all time, Jane Austen’s masterpiece, PRIDE AND PREJUDICE.
This edition adheres to the original 1813 text, has been carefully proofread for errors, and elegantly and expertly formatted for Kindle ereaders."It is a truth universally acknowledged, that a single man in possession of a good fortune, must be in want of a wife."
